A technician is performing a cranking compression test on a 4 cylinder engine, cylinders 1-3 have 130 psi of compression. Cylinder no.4 only has 60 psi of compression, so he injects oil into that cylinder and repeats the test. He now sees 125 psi of compression on cylinder 4, what is most likely wrong with this cylinder?
Worn piston compression rings.
Faulty intake valve
Faulty exhaust valve
Leaking intake manifold

When testing an engine's intake manifold vacuum, a technician sees a steady reading of 21 in.hg. on the gauge. What does this mean?
Faulty intake valve
Faulty exhaust valve
Restriction in the exhaust system
Normal reading
